Cloudflare's Brand Marketing team is responsible for increasing awareness, affinity, and preference for the Cloudflare brand. We are looking for a Brand Campaign Manager, Thought Leadership to help manage and support our high-impact executive programs - using owned, earned, and paid channels to create influential and thought provoking engagement with senior leaders at customer organizations.
Responsibilities:
- Own program operations for theNET, a publication dedicated to technology business leaders.
- Maintain, nurture, and grow executive subscriber-base.
- Design integrated programs to engage decision makers in support of marketing priorities.
- Collaborate with Content Writers, Design Studio, Marketing Operations, Web Strategy, and Localization to publish quality content, creative, and program assets.
- Work with Cloudflare executives to deliver peer-based thought leadership.
- Deliver measurable results to global stakeholders and use data to inform promotional strategy.
- Collaborate with Email, Social, PR, and Advertising to extend content to owned, earned, and paid channels.
- Expertise in content marketing to influence an executive audience.
- At least 5+ years of content strategy and execution.
- Enterprise B2B technology industry experience, with cyber security a plus.
- Proficiency in organic social media marketing.
- Competency in SEO best practices.
- Experience with a variety of content marketing tools, tactics, and channels. Familiarity with Contentful, Asana, and Figma a plus.
- Organized and results oriented.
Compensation may be adjusted depending on work location.
- For New York City, Washington, and California (excluding Bay Area) based hires: Estimated annual salary of $115,000 - $141,000
- For Bay Area-based hires: Estimated annual salary of $122,000 - $149,000
This role is eligible to participate in Cloudflare's equity plan.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ene
San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.
Key Facts About San Francisco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
-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
-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
